Linux Kernel up to 5.15.136/6.1.58/6.5.7 mctp mctp_route_lookup/mctp_route_lookup_null information disclosure

A vulnerability marked as problematic has been reported in Linux Kernel up to 5.15.136/6.1.58/6.5.7. This vulnerability affects the function mctp_route_lookup/mctp_route_lookup_null of the component mctp. The manipulation leads to information disclosure. This vulnerability is listed as CVE-2023-52483. There is no available exploit. It is suggested to upgrade the affected component.

A vulnerability was found in Linux Kernel up to 5.15.136/6.1.58/6.5.7 (Operating System). It has been rated as problematic. This issue affects the function mctp_route_lookup/mctp_route_lookup_null of the component mctp. The manipulation with an unknown input leads to a information disclosure vulnerability. Using CWE to declare the problem leads to CWE-200. The product exposes sensitive information to an actor that is not explicitly authorized to have access to that information. Impacted is confidentiality. The summary by CVE is:

In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: mctp: perform route lookups under a RCU read-side lock Our current route lookups (mctp_route_lookup and mctp_route_lookup_null) traverse the net's route list without the RCU read lock held. This means the route lookup is subject to preemption, resulting in an potential grace period expiry, and so an eventual kfree() while we still have the route pointer. Add the proper read-side critical section locks around the route lookups, preventing premption and a possible parallel kfree. The remaining net->mctp.routes accesses are already under a rcu_read_lock, or protected by the RTNL for updates. Based on an analysis from Sili Luo , where introducing a delay in the route lookup could cause a UAF on simultaneous sendmsg() and route deletion.

The weakness was presented 02/29/2024. It is possible to read the advisory at git.kernel.org. The identification of this vulnerability is CVE-2023-52483 since 02/20/2024. Technical details of the vulnerability are known, but there is no available exploit. The attack technique deployed by this issue is T1592 according to MITRE ATT&CK.

The vulnerability scanner Nessus provides a plugin with the ID 239841 (TencentOS Server 4: kernel (TSSA-2024:0960)), which helps to determine the existence of the flaw in a target environment.

Upgrading to version 5.15, 5.15.137, 6.1.59, 6.5.8 or 6.6 eliminates this vulnerability. Applying the patch 6c52b1215904/1db0724a01b5/2405f64a95a7/5093bbfc10ab is able to eliminate this problem. The bugfix is ready for download at git.kernel.org. The best possible mitigation is suggested to be upgrading to the latest version.
